AF07 EHM is a 2007 Toyota Land Cruiser in Silver with a 2,982c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 2 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 2007 Toyota Land Cruiser models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.0% with a typical mileage of 92,642 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Toyota Land Cruiser f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 10,265 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AF07 EHM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ota Land Cruiser typ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 19 years old, this Toyota Land Cruiser is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
